Job Description

A highly respected boutique estate planning practice is seeking a polished Administrative Assistant / Paralegal to serve as a true right hand to a senior partner.

Job Responsibility

  • Manage complex scheduling, travel arrangements, and calendar coordination
  • Draft, edit, and finalize legal documents and client communications
  • Serve as a professional point of contact for clients and external partners
  • Track attorney time and maintain organized files and shared systems
  • Anticipate needs and deliver ahead of deadlines—before being asked
  • Handle day-to-day administrative functions including scanning, filing, and document management
  • Prepare spreadsheets and assist with data tracking/reporting

Requirements

  • Meticulous attention to detail with exceptional follow-up (and follow-through!)
  • Strong written communication—clear, polished, and grammatically sound emails
  • Tech-savvy with MS Word, Outlook, Excel, and document systems
  • Self-sufficient and resourceful—minimal hand-holding required
  • Ability to thrive under pressure in a fast-paced, high-expectations environment
  • Professional presence—reliable, confident, and client-facing ready
  • Ability to interpret direction and think critically to connect the dots

Nice to have

  • Paralegal certificate
  • Notary (or willingness to obtain)
